43 in state receive Merit Scholarships

Students among 2,200 named in U.S.

Forty-three members of the Arkansas high school Class of 2015 are among about 2,200 new graduates nationally to be named this week as winners of National Merit Scholarships that are financed by colleges and universities.

The awards range from $500 to $2,000 annually for up to four years of study at the campuses funding the scholarships.

The recipients named this week are the third group of high school seniors to be named National Merit Scholarship winners. Other recipients were named April 22 and May 6. Another group will be announced July 13.
